Port of Paranaguá receives 20 armored vehicles from the Army manufactured in the USA

The Port of Paranaguá moved a different load this Tuesday (8). The Brazilian Army opted for the strategic location and expertise of Paraná’s stowage to receive 20 special armored 6×6 rescue vehicles, manufactured in Detroit, in the United States.

The armored vehicles were transported by the Arc Resolve cargo ship, ro-ro type, used to transport vehicles, rolling or special cargo.

“The Port of Paranaguá has agility in loading and unloading vehicles. In addition, port workers are highly qualified and recognized throughout the country for operating with this type of cargo”, highlights the director-president of Portos do Paraná, Luiz Fernando Garcia.

Before reaching their destination, the armored vehicles left the Port of Savannah, in Georgia, in the USA, and passed through the Port of Manzanillo, in Panama.

According to Colonel Éder Valério Pellegrini, from the Command of the 5th Military Region, the purchase began in 2018 with the purpose of complementing the operational capacity of Guarani Armored Vehicles, used in the transport of personnel, produced in Brazil.

“The new vehicles can be used as a winch support for up to 42 tons of cargo, for rescue maneuvers and the rescue of damaged vehicles in combat”, he explains.

The MaxxPro Recovery Vehicle model armored vehicles are equipped with a rear delta wing and a hydraulic lance with electronic access, in addition to being able to withstand shots from 5.56 and 7.62 millimeter weapons.

Colonel Luiz Henrique Salonski da Silva, from the Logistic Command, in Brasília, explains that the acquisition is part of the strategic program “Forças Armoradas”, of the Brazilian Army.

“The vehicles will be distributed to logistical battalions throughout the country, in addition to military schools”, he says. “The transport of armored vehicles will be coordinated by the Logistics Section of the Command of the 5th Army Division, using the 27th Logistic Battalion and 5th Logistic Battalion, with flatbed trucks, to the Regional Maintenance Park of the 5th Military Region, in Curitiba”.

In the capital of Paraná, the vehicles will actually be received by the Army and a course will be given to operators from all regions of the country.

According to Pellegrini, Paranaguá is a port that has expertise in receiving military vehicles. He explains that more than 100 armored vehicles were landed by cranes or ro-ro ships. “In addition to the proximity to Curitiba, the availability of the Port of Paranaguá in support makes it an old partner for this activity”, he justifies.

In the coming months, according to the military, the port in Paraná should receive containers with vehicle parts and another 30 military vehicles.
